Image
Image

无法去污粉

+ 关注

粉丝 1     |     主题 57     |     回帖 808

MSP430使用指南- Timer定时器模块
2023-10-19 16:02
  • TI MCU
  • 58
  • 3652
  这个功能就是在输出比较模式下,这几个通道可以同时成组的去更新数据,用于多个输出比较形成同步的功能。 ...  
  其次没有SCCI,因此也就没有这个设定位了。 最后就是Group,看下面寄存器截图: ...  
  先说第一条:B可以设定成8,10,12,16位模式,也就是说计数的最大值不同,这个在TBxCTL中你会发现多了CNT ...  
  先看一下结构图的区别:B可以成组,因此多了TBCLGRP,其次可以设置成8,10,12,16位模式,因此多了CNTL位 ...  
  ......  
  下面看一下Timer_B,和Timer_A基本都没区别,功能,使用方法等,那么回归最初的问题,区别在那些地方呢: B ...  
  输出比较功能(输出两路PWM波,频率1KHz,占空比分别为25%和75%)  
  ......  
  输入捕捉功能 (开始捕捉中断,捕捉到20个脉冲后反转P1.1口,同时记录下每个脉冲时刻的计数器的值) ...  
  ......  
STM32F4_随机数发生器(RNG)
2023-12-27 12:55
  • ST MCU
  • 20
  • 993
  位31:4 保留,必须保持复位值 位3 IE:中断使能(Interrupt enable) 0:禁止RNG中断 ...  
  4. RNG寄存器 4.1 RNG控制寄存器:RNG_CR RNG控制寄存器:RNG_CR(RNG control register) ...  
  按照FIPS PUB(联邦信息处理标准出版物)140-2的要求,将RNGEN位置1后产生的第一个随机数不应使用,应保存 ...  
  总结:出现错误时,应将SEIS位清零,然后将RNGEN位清零并置1,以便重新初始化和重新启动RNG。 ...  
  ②:如果SEIS位的值为1,则表示种子出现了错误 出现种子错误时,只要SECS位为1,就会中断随机数产生。如果 ...  
  这里检查未出现错误时,RNG_SR寄存器的SEIS和CEIS位为0;如果SEIS和CEIS其中之一为1,则表示随机数发生器出 ...  
  3. 每次中断时,检查确认未出现错误(RNG_SR寄存器中的SEIS和CEIS位应为0),并且随机数已准备就绪(RNG_SR ...  
  2. 通过将RNG_CR控制寄存器中的RNGEN位置1使能随机数产生。这会激活模拟部分、RNG_LFSR和错误检测器。 ...  
  3. 运行RNG 想要运行随机数发生器RNG,需要: 1. 如果需要随机数发生器RNG,进行中断(将RNG_CR控制寄存器 ...  
  首先模拟种子源源不断的生成随机数据给馈送线性反馈移位寄存器LFSR,当LFSR存储满之后,会一并给数 ...  
2
3
近期访客